I have to admit, not infering that LEA adopt this type of procedure, but I have never understood this putting tech items in emails. I have witnessed in several companies this practice and wonder why a Captain would do this. The Captain would say, well I'm doing this to help the company out, yeah that might be true, but what about the next crew who take it over - are they full aware of all defects, and what happens if they arent happy to fly plane, now there the bad guys if they tech it, and then the list of items gets longer. Also what is the position if you hand over aircraft with known defects and do not tech it - could you as previous crew be partly responsible if the next crew have an accident. In a perfect world items should be put in tech log, and if they can be defered, then defer items. This then gives operation a chance to plan for said maintenace - job done. However we are rarely in the perfect world and this is where we need good judgement.
